My Phaser 360 does the following:
When warming up and the printer gets into the 90% range it displays the message ink sticks jammed, so i open the ink bay cover and wiggle the sticks about, but i also notice that the ink melters are not hot as they sahould be so they can melt the sticks, so the sticks are not stuck as they should be.
Anyways this happens a few times before it finishes warming up and then the printer displays the following error: 09,008.43:74479.

That error points to the black ink melt heater, heater is on but ink is not dripping. 3 successive ink stick jams will create this error. there may well be a problem with teh heating element. You can check to see if the ceramic element underneath is intact or cracked. Replacing teh ink loader should resolve this problem.
 
This may be the heater, but I have also seen that when you do not use Tektronix brand wax, you get the same problem. I have a customer that wants to save money by buying the 3rd party wax. It appears to be a little harder than Tektronix brand wax. Hence, it takes more heat to melt the wax and you then get the error message.
